E30
V-ZUG
General Water System Fault
Washer shows E30 and will not start or stops with water in drum

Possible Causes
Conflicting signals from pressure sensor, Inlet valve malfunction, Drain pump not operating correctly, Control module water management error
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Disconnect mains power and close the water tap before working on the water system.
- 1. Note when E30 occurs: If it appears during filling, suspect inlet/pressure sensor. If during draining, suspect pump/pressure sensor.
- 2. Check pressure sensor and hose: Inspect and clear the pressure hose and verify sensor connections as described for E04.
- 3. Verify inlet and drain: Confirm that the inlet valve fills correctly (E02 checks) and that the drain pump empties the drum (E03/E20 checks).
- 4. Power reset: After checks, unplug for 10 minutes, reconnect, and run a short program to test.
- 5. Replace faulty parts: Replace the V-ZUG pressure sensor, inlet valve, or drain pump as indicated by testing.
- 6. Technician service: Persistent E30 with all hardware verified suggests a control module fault requiring professional diagnosis.
